ASTM E1340-05(2010)
Guía estándar para la creación rápida de prototipos de sistemas de información

Estándar No.
ASTM E1340-05(2010)
Fecha de publicación
2005
Organización
American Society for Testing and Materials (ASTM)
Estado
 2017-01
Ultima versión
ASTM E1340-05(2010)
Alcance
La creación rápida de prototipos (RP) es un modelo de ciclo de vida específico que se utiliza para desarrollar un sistema de información que produce un modelo funcional del sistema muy rápidamente. El proceso de RP que se muestra en la Fig. 1 tiene muchas similitudes y algunas diferencias con el proceso de desarrollo del sistema convencional (Modelo de ciclo de vida en cascada) que se muestra en la Fig. 2. RP reemplaza los procesos de Requisitos y Diseño del método convencional con un proceso iterativo de prototipo. refinamiento. Mientras que las fases del método convencional producen un conjunto de documentos que describen el sistema, RP produce un prototipo. El prototipo se prueba y perfecciona a través de varias iteraciones, con una intensa interacción entre los usuarios y los desarrolladores del sistema. RP es un enfoque experimental para el desarrollo de sistemas que proporciona un dispositivo de aprendizaje, el prototipo, para usuarios y desarrolladores. Un prototipo se puede utilizar como herramienta para aclarar los requisitos del sistema operativo, como medio para evaluar un enfoque de diseño o como una serie de versiones en desarrollo del sistema operativo. A veces se utiliza un prototipo como especificación de comportamiento exacta para un sistema operativo que lo reemplaza. Las características de calidad a menudo se sacrifican durante la PR en aras de un desarrollo rápido y un bajo costo; La solidez, la eficiencia, la generalidad, la portabilidad y la mantenibilidad se suelen ignorar, pero ninguno de estos aspectos debe descuidarse. Sin embargo, no se puede ignorar la documentación necesaria para utilizar el sistema, pero ninguno de estos aspectos debe descuidarse. Un producto "desechable" El prototipo se utiliza específicamente para definir los requisitos que se utilizan para implementar un sistema final. Un modelo &#“evolutivo” prototipo es un sistema prototípico que se utiliza para el refinamiento continuo de los requisitos, mientras que las versiones operativas en hitos específicos se utilizan en entornos de producción. Rápido en RP significa que el tiempo entre versiones sucesivas del prototipo es relativamente corto. Debe ser lo suficientemente breve como para que (1) tanto los usuarios como los desarrolladores puedan recordar cómo se relaciona cada versión con la anterior sin notas escritas, (2) los requisitos del usuario no cambien significativamente mientras se desarrolla una versión, (3) el equipo de creación de prototipos permanecer en el proyecto durante la fase de RP, y (4) el tiempo total para desarrollar el sistema es aceptable. (La duración esperada del proyecto debe indicarse en el documento de planificación de la dirección del proyecto. Consulte la Sección 6 y ANSI/IEEE 1058 y ANSI/IEEE 1074). Unos pocos días entre versiones es adecuado y unas pocas semanas pueden ser aceptables. Si el tiempo necesario para producir una nueva versión es mayor, entonces puede ser necesario producir esa versión utilizando un método de desarrollo de sistema convencional con documentación completa de requisitos y diseño (ver Apéndice X3). RP integra análisis, diseño y construcción, y define Requisitos durante el proceso. Es especialmente apropiado para abordar problemas que no se comprenden bien o que cambian rápidamente. El prototipo centra la comunicación entre usuarios y desarrolladores. Para sistemas grandes, se puede utilizar un enfoque RP a alto nivel para explorar la arquitectura o viabilidad general del sistema. También se puede utilizar para desarrollar subsistemas y componentes cuyos requisitos no se comprenden completamente (consulte la Sección 11). RP es especialmente adecuado para desarrollar interfaces usuario-sistema. Qué prototipo8212; Los problemas de desarrollo de sistemas mal estructurados que rinden mejor para la PR incluyen: Sistemas de soporte de decisiones en áreas donde el estado del conocimiento cambia rápidamente, por ejemplo, investigación o práctica clínica, Sistemas cuyos usuarios necesitan acceder y... .......

ASTM E1340-05(2010) Documento de referencia

  • ANSI/IEEE 1016 Estándar para tecnología de la información - Diseño de sistemas - Descripciones de diseño de software*2023-11-05 Actualizar
  • ANSI/IEEE 1063 Estándar para la documentación del usuario de software
  • ANSI/IEEE 1074 Estándar para desarrollar un proceso de ciclo de vida de un proyecto de software

ASTM E1340-05(2010) Historia

  • 2005 ASTM E1340-05(2010) Guía estándar para la creación rápida de prototipos de sistemas de información
  • 2005 ASTM E1340-05 Guía estándar para la creación rápida de prototipos de sistemas de información
  • 1996 ASTM E1340-96 Guía estándar para la creación rápida de prototipos de sistemas computarizados



© 2023 Reservados todos los derechos.